About: Royal Derby Hospital

(as the patient),

What I liked

Caring and respectful attention to my needs.

First class care and treatment.

Everything involved carefully explained.

Understanding of my particular situation.

What could be improved

I was told I would be able to have gas to put me to sleep before the procedures for the general anaesthetic but this was dismissed by the anaesthetist. As a result I became very sick & in danger of blacking out as the procedure commenced. However the staff were quick to rectify the situation.

Anything else?

Day case, five hours in and out! brilliant!
